Freedom House promotes the spread of freedom and democracy around the world through research, effective advocacy, and programs that support frontline activists. We are a leader in identifying threats to freedom through our highly regarded analytic reports, including Freedom in the World, Freedom of the Press, Freedom on the Net, Nations in Transit, and Countries at the Crossroads. With 13 field offices and two U.S. offices, we support the right of every individual to be free.
Position Summary
The Monitoring & Evaluation (M&E) Analyst will perform responsibilities necessary to day-to-day monitoring of the impact of program activities. She/he will assist with program design, the development of monitoring and evaluation plans and tools, data management and analysis, program reporting and maintenance of the Performance Management Plan, and production of analysis. This position is based in Mexico City and repots to the Project Director.
